OpenSBI also +supports Hart State Management (HSM) SBI extension starting from OpenSBI v0.7. +HSM extension allows S-mode software to boot all the harts a defined order +rather than legacy method of random booting of harts. As a result, many +required features such as CPU hotplug, kexec/kdump can also be supported easily +in S-mode. HSM extension in OpenSBI is implemented in a non-backward compatible +manner to reduce the maintenance burden and avoid confusion. That's why, any +S-mode software using OpenSBI will not be able to boot more than 1 hart if HSM +extension is not supported in S-mode. + +Linux kernel already supports SBI v0.2 and HSM SBI extension starting from +**v5.7-rc1**. If you are using an Linux kernel older than **5.7-rc1** or any +other S-mode software without HSM SBI extension, you should stick to OpenSBI +v0.6 to boot all the harts. For a UMP systems, it doesn't matter. + +N.B. Any S-mode boot loader (i.e. U-Boot) doesn't need to support HSM extension, +as it doesn't need to boot all the harts. The operating system should be +capable enough to bring up all other non-booting harts using HSM extension. + Required Toolchain ------------------
